===== initWithInteger =====
- (id)initWithInteger:(NSInteger)value NS_AVAILABLE(10_5, 2_0);
===== ObjC Sourcecode Example =====
NSInteger myInteger = 20;
//******************** Initializing NSNumber Object *************************
//** NSNumbers need to be released, if you`re not working with ARC! **
NSNumber *myIntegerNumber = [[NSNumber alloc]initWithInteger:myInteger];
NSLog(@"myIntegerNumber: %@", myIntegerNumber);
==== Output for this example code ====
2012-08-31 22:37:05.699 NSNumberSample[808:f803] myIntegerNumber: 20